As discussed in previous newsletters, our market continues

to benefit from people wanting to escape from other parts of the country and the world, live in warmer climates, and enjoy the wonderful lifestyle and amenities of the lake country. As a result, the number of buyers (demand) continues to be strong. While the inventory of existing homes is lower than demand, new construction and development have increased over the past year. Consequently, it is a very favorable market for both buyers and sellers. While the continued higher interest rates are still a challenge, we forecast that our market will continue to be strong and attractive in 2025.

You can see from the statistics below that the Lake Oconee market was very similar from 2024 to 2023 with modest increases in some sectors.

May 16

Claude Bourbon, Progressive Blues

The Arts Barn, 100 Ulysses Rice Ct, Eatonton Time: 7– 11:00 PM

Ready for a unique and talented take on a wide range of musical traditions? Claude Bourbon is known throughout Europe and America for amazing guitar performances that take blues, Spanish, and Middle Eastern stylings into uncharted territories. Claude’s inimitable style incorporates all five digits on each hand dancing independently but in unison, plucking, picking and strumming at such speed and precision that his fingers often seem to melt into a blur. Thousands of people in the UK, Europe and USA have enjoyed listening to this virtuoso and for the majority of his audience it is an experience that compels them to return again and again to hear and watch him play, as his fingers lightly dance over the strings of his guitar and create a unique sound that is ’Claude’.

JUNE

June 2 - 8

Lake Country Classic Pickeball Tournament & Grand Opening

Walter B Williams Park, 59 GA-22, Milledgeville

The Milledgeville Pickleball Club is hosting the firstever Lake Country Classic Tournament and a full week of events in celebration of the new pickleball courts at Walter B. Williams Park from June 2nd to June 8th, featuring a variety of community and competitive pickleball activities. Schedule as follows: Monday, June 2 – Community Doubles Mixer

and JUNE...

A free event open to all community members. Registration is required.

Tuesday, June 3 – Community Family Night

Families are invited to enjoy a casual night of play— paddles and balls will be provided. The evening will feature an exhibition match between the “Inflatable Egos” at 6:00 PM. Free with registration.

Wednesday, June 4 – Community Men’s and Women’s Doubles. Separate doubles matches for men and women. Free to participate. Registration is required.

Thursday, June 5 – Inter-City Challenge Day

Morning Match (60+, 3.0 skill level) – Begins at 9:00 AM. Entry: $50 per team.

Evening Match (All ages, 3.5+ skill level) – Begins at 6:30 PM. Entry: $50 per team.

Milly Bragging Rights Tournament – Sponsored team play begins at 5:30 PM. Entry: $250 per team.

Friday–Sunday, June 6–8 – Lake Country Classic Tournament

The weekend will feature competitive singles, gender doubles, and mixed doubles brackets. Registration required. For more details and registration links, please visit the Milledgeville Pickleball Club’s official website: milledgevillepickleball.com

June 6

Full Moon Float

Oconee Outfitters / Oconee River Greenway, 420 E Green St, Milledgeville

Time: call 478-452-3890

Mark your calendars for Oconee Outfitter’s popular nighttime kayak event! Experience kayaking the Oconee River by the light of the full moon.

Rentals are available for $55/single kayak, or $85/ tandem kayak or canoe. Shuttle only for personal boats is $15/single kayak, or $25/tandem. Call Oconee Outfitters to make your reservations. Come out and howl at the moon!
